清乾隆 剔紅八吉祥紋「大吉」葫蘆瓶

- Mother of pearl, lacquer
the auspicious form with slightly flattened sides, the edges articulated in plain narrow bands, the upper bulb set with a central medallion to either side enclosing a mother-of-pearl inlaid Da character on a gilt-lacquer ground and bordered by further mother-of-pearl, the lower bulb with a Ji character within similarly decorated medallions, all reserved against finely carved scrolling peony blooms and the bajixiang on a wan diaper ground

Condition
There are several restorations to the body, including a restored break running through the lower bulb on one side with some associated minor losses. A few small losses to the mother-of-pearl inlay, and some small sections have been replaced. The rim and base re-lacquered, possibly restored as well. The surface with black staining.

拍品資料及來源
Vases of this somewhat flattened form are exceedingly rare as is the unusual addition of mother-of-pearl inlay. A vase of the same form and decoration but with the Da Ji characters in gilt metal on a blue enamel ground is in the Victoria and Albert Museum and illustrated in Edward F, Strange, Catalogue of Chinese Lacquer, London, 1925, cat. no. 33, pl. XV.
